Flood Water Extraction vs. DIY: When to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small water leak (less than 100 sq. Ft.) | Yes | No | DIY is suitable for small leaks, but be sure to act quickly to prevent further damage. |
| Large water leak (over 100 sq. Ft.) | No | Yes | A large water leak needs professional equipment and expertise to prevent further damage and ensure your property is safe to enter. |
| Standing water (over 2 inches deep) | No | Yes | Standing water poses a serious health risk and needs professional extraction equipment to prevent further damage. |
| Mold growth | No | Yes | Mold growth needs professional sanitizing and remediation to prevent health risks and ensure your property is safe to enter. |
| Water damage (over $1,000) | No | Yes | Water damage over $1,000 needs professional expertise and equipment to prevent further damage and ensure your property is restored to its original condition. |

Flood Water Extraction Cost in Eatontown, NJ
The cost of Flood Water Extraction can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Eatontown, NJ. |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water Extraction |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area, depth of standing water, and equipment required |
| Drying |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of affected area, type of drying equipment required, and duration of drying process |
| Sanitizing |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area, type of sanitizing products required, and duration of sanitizing process |
| Removal of Debris | $500 – $2,000 | Size of debris, type of removal equipment required, and duration of removal process |
| Temporary Repairs |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of affected area, type of temporary repairs required, and duration of repair process |
